About High Wych Church of England Primary School

High Wych Church of England Primary School is a state primary for mixed pupils aged 3 to 11, located in East Hertfordshire. With 227 pupils on roll against a capacity of 210, the school is running slightly over its official limit, which aligns with its clear popularity among local families. For the 2025/26 admissions cycle, the school received 96 applications for just 30 places, giving an oversubscription ratio of 3.2, and only 20 first-preference offers were made. That level of demand suggests a school that families in the area are actively choosing. The proportion of pupils eligible for free school meals stands at 13.6%, which is below the national average for primary schools, indicating a relatively affluent intake. The school has a Church of England religious character and is led by headteacher Michelle Moulsher. It also offers nursery provision, so children can join before Reception.

Academically, High Wych performs well above the local authority average. In the 2023/24 Key Stage 2 assessments, 73% of pupils reached the expected standard in reading, writing and maths combined, compared with a Hertfordshire average of 64%. The school’s score of 73 places it 12th out of 47 primary schools in East Hertfordshire, putting it in the top 25% locally, and 304th out of 1,612 in the East of England region. Subject-level results are strong: 83% met the expected standard in both reading and maths, and 87% did so in writing. At the higher standard, 47% achieved that level in maths, 27% in reading and 20% in writing. Average scaled scores were 108 in maths and 107 in reading. The school’s most recent Ofsted inspection, in November 2023, confirmed it remains Good, with leadership and management also rated Good. Its previous graded inspection in 2013 had rated it Requires Improvement, so the trajectory is clearly positive.

The school is well equipped, with facilities including a library, playing fields, art studios, a sports hall, gymnasium, sensory room, ICT suite and a chapel. Sports on offer include gymnastics, netball, tennis, football and cross country, while clubs range from coding and drama to eco club and book club. For pupils with additional needs, the school lists provisions for specific learning difficulties like dyslexia, moderate learning difficulty, social, emotional and mental health needs, speech and language communication needs, physical disability and autistic spectrum disorder. The nearest Outstanding-rated primary is Fawbert and Barnard Infants’ School, 2.3 km away. High Wych suits families who want a popular, oversubscribed village primary with strong academic outcomes, a Church of England ethos, and a broad range of facilities and clubs, all within a relatively affluent catchment area.
